On , OSHA opened a complaint safety inspection of BROOK FURNITURE RENTAL, INC. in 6702 A JIMMY CARTER BLVD, NORCROSS, GA 30071 (NAICS 532299). OSHA activity number 338976798.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.134(c): The employer did not develop and implement a written respiratory protection program with required worksite-specific procedures and elements for required respirator use. On 3/25/13, at the Norcross facility, the employer did not implement the company's written respiratory protection program for employees assigned to use tight fitting 1/2 mask respirators. In accordance with 29 CFR 1903.19(c), abatement certification is required for this violation (using the CERTIFICATION OF CORRECTIVE ACTION WORKSHEET).

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.151(c): Where employees were exposed to injurious corrosive materials, suitable facilities for quick drenching or flushing of the eyes and body were not provided within the work area for immediate emergency use. On 3/25/13, in the warehouse area, the employer did not ensure an emergency eye wash was provided at the battery charging station that would provide 15 minutes of flush. General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.176(b): Material stored in tiers was not stacked, blocked, interlocked or limited in height so that it was stable and secure against sliding and collapse. On 3/25/13, in the warehouse area, furniture was stacked unsecured to a height of 22' adjacent to aisles and walkways. General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.305(b)(1)(ii): Unused openings in boxes, cabinets, or fittings were not effectively closed. On 3/25/13, in the warehouse area, at the HA 480 volt panel, unused breaker openings were not protected with blanks or coverings to guard exposure to the live electrical parts in the panel.
